3.3 - x = 3(x - 1.7)
First you simplify the part on the right with the distributive prop.
3.3 - x = 3x - 5.1
Second you add the lowest X, which is - x to both sides
3.3 - x + x = 3x + x - 5.1
3.3 = 4x - 5.1
Then add the 5.1 to make problem easir to solve
3.3 + 5.1 = 4x - 5.1 + 5.1
8.4 = 4x
Then divide.
8.4/4 = 2.1
X = 2.1

first get rid of the brackets:
3.3-x = 3x-5.1
then get x to one side (here by adding +x to both sides):
3.3 = 4x-5.1
now let x stand alone on one side (adding +5.1 to both sides):
8.4 = 4x
and finally you get:
2.1 = x
